BALSAMIC GRILLED ZUCCHINI



Balsamic Grilled Zucchini image

A simple, easy grilled zucchini with a touch of balsamic vinegar and spices.

Time 15m

Yield 4

Number Of Ingredients 6

2 zucchinis, quartered lengthwise
2 teaspoons olive oil
½ teaspoon garlic powder
1 teaspoon Italian seasoning
1 pinch salt
2 tablespoons balsamic vinegar

Steps:

  • Preheat grill for medium-low heat and lightly oil the grate.
  • Brush zucchini with olive oil. Sprinkle garlic powder, Italian seasoning, and salt over zucchini.
  • Cook on preheated grill until beginning to brown, 3-4 minutes per side. Brush balsamic vinegar over the zucchini and continue cooking 1 minute more. Serve immediately.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 37.6 calories, Carbohydrate 3.6 g, Fat 2.5 g, Fiber 0.8 g, Protein 0.8 g, SaturatedFat 0.4 g, Sodium 8 mg, Sugar 2.2 g

GRILLED ZUCCHINI



Grilled Zucchini image

A grilling recipe that is easy to prepare, tasty as a appetizer or a side dish.

Time 20m

Yield 6

Number Of Ingredients 7

⅓ cup extra-virgin olive oil
1 teaspoon sea salt
2 cloves garlic, minced
1 tablespoon chopped fresh rosemary
½ teaspoon ground black pepper
6 small zucchini, sliced lengthwise into 1/4-inch thick strips
3 tablespoons balsamic vinegar

Steps:

  • Preheat grill for medium heat and lightly oil the grate.
  • Whisk olive oil, sea salt, garlic, rosemary, and black pepper together in a bowl; brush evenly onto zucchini strips.
  • Cook on preheated grill until brown, 5 to 7 minutes per side; transfer to a serving platter. Drizzle balsamic vinegar over zucchini to serve.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 138.1 calories, Carbohydrate 5.6 g, Fat 12.7 g, Fiber 1.4 g, Protein 1.5 g, SaturatedFat 1.8 g, Sodium 307.4 mg, Sugar 3.2 g

EASY GRILLED ZUCCHINI



Easy Grilled Zucchini image

Great summer vegetable to go along side your burgers.

Time 20m

Yield 4

Number Of Ingredients 3

1 tablespoon olive oil
3 zucchinis, sliced 1/4-inch thick, lengthwise
1 tablespoon grill seasoning

Steps:

  • Preheat grill for medium heat and lightly oil the grate.
  • Drizzle zucchini slices on both sides with olive oil and season with grill seasoning.
  • Grill zucchinis on preheated grill until tender, 3 to 4 minutes per side.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 57.8 calories, Carbohydrate 5.7 g, Fat 3.7 g, Fiber 1.9 g, Protein 1.9 g, SaturatedFat 0.5 g, Sodium 380.8 mg, Sugar 2.6 g

GRILLED ZUCCHINI SLICES



Grilled Zucchini Slices image

Grilled zucchini that can be used in place of the French fry.

Time 1h

Yield 2

Number Of Ingredients 5

1 tablespoon olive oil
1 ½ teaspoons onion powder
1 ½ teaspoons seasoned salt
1 ½ teaspoons garlic powder
2 zucchini, thinly sliced lengthwise and 1/4-inch wide

Steps:

  • Whisk olive oil, onion powder, seasoned salt, and garlic powder together in a bowl; add zucchini and marinate for about 30 minutes.
  • Preheat grill for medium heat and lightly oil the grate.
  • Grill zucchini slices on the preheated grill for about 10 minutes. Flip and grill until edges are crisp and grill marks are present, about 10 minutes more.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 106.9 calories, Carbohydrate 10.1 g, Fat 7.2 g, Fiber 2.5 g, Protein 3 g, SaturatedFat 1 g, Sodium 709.3 mg, Sugar 4.5 g

QUICK BBQ ZUCCHINI



Quick BBQ Zucchini image

Another quick and tasty way to do vegetables on the BBQ. No need to measure ingredients but don't go overboard on the herbs.

Time 12m

Yield 2 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 5

1 medium zucchini
1/8 teaspoon dried dill
1/8 teaspoon dried oregano
1/8 teaspoon ground black pepper
1 teaspoon extra virgin olive oil

Steps:

  • Slice zucchini in half length wise and then cut into serving pieces of around 5cm (2 inches).
  • Lightly sprinkle with dill, oregano and pepper, then drizzle olive oil over the top.
  • BBQ on oiled hotplate over low-medium temperature for around 4 minutes skin down, 3 minutes face down and a final 3 minutes skin down.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 37.2, Fat 2.6, SaturatedFat 0.4, Sodium 8.1, Carbohydrate 3.2, Fiber 1.1, Sugar 2.5, Protein 1.2

Tips:

  • Choose the right zucchini: Select firm and medium-sized zucchini with deep green color and no blemishes.
  • Slice zucchini evenly: Consistent thickness ensures even cooking.
  • Marinate zucchini: Marinating adds flavor and moisture. Use a mixture of olive oil, herbs, spices, and seasonings.
  • Grill zucchini over medium heat: Prevents burning and allows zucchini to cook evenly.
  • Flip zucchini once: Avoid over-handling to prevent zucchini from breaking.
  • Cook zucchini until tender-crisp: Zucchini should retain a slight crunch.
  • Serve zucchini immediately: Grilled zucchini is best enjoyed hot off the grill.
